发明名称 BATTERY CHARGING DEVICE, 3-PHASE VOLTAGE GENERATION CIRCUIT, 3-PHASE VOLTAGE GENERATION METHOD, AND DELAY ANGLE CONTROL METHOD
摘要 In a battery charging device, a U-, V-, W-phase voltage generation circuit (11) detects a voltage signal Vu of a sub-coil Su of the U-phase of a 3-phase AC generator (1) and generates a rectangular wave signal synchronized with the U-phase. The U-, V-, W-phase voltage generation circuit (11) generates a first triangular wave in synchronization with the phase from 0 to 180 degrees of the U-phase and a second triangular wave in synchronization with the phase from 180 to 360 degrees. The U-, V-, W-phase voltage generation circuit (11) generates: a V-phase rectangular wave having a level inverted at the voltage point of 2/3 of the peak voltage of the first triangular wave and inverted at the voltage point of 2/3 of the peak voltage of the second triangular wave; and a W-phase rectangular wave having a level inverted at the voltage point of 1/3 of the peak voltage of the first triangular wave and inverted at the voltage point of 1/3 of the peak voltage of the second triangular wave.
